Output 3795fe95042e287c17f56c7bcbe4fdfafa2d0c587b50e5dc2ecc4ae3d6a6bbe7:2

value
4265743
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a2ef1454e3c4faac191bc9b57f66973df91fe769 OP_EQUAL
address
3GYXo9dbGkSrvzArJ4teHVg4MGRYkMyr3C
transaction
3795fe95042e287c17f56c7bcbe4fdfafa2d0c587b50e5dc2ecc4ae3d6a6bbe7
confirmations
310173
spent
true